GEMOVE: Journal of Gender, Movement, and Empowerment is a peer-reviewed journal published by the Lombok Business Academy. It focuses on gender economics, equal access to resources, women’s entrepreneurship, and community-based economic empowerment. The journal explores issues of wage inequality, decent work, labour protection, and gender-based economic vulnerability, while highlighting women’s social movements, innovation, and technology for empowerment. Integrating feminist, political economy, and ecofeminist perspectives, GEMOVE promotes sustainable and gender-just economic development.
